Attorney general warns about scam
BISMARCK, N.D. (AP) — Attorney General Wayne Stenehjem says scam artists posing as state crime bureau agents are telephoning North Dakotans and offering to remove criminal charges for $500.

Stenehjem says it is a ridiculous scam but he wants to warn state residents so that no one is unwittingly tricked out of money.
He says the goal of the scam artists is to get unwary consumers to reveal personal information such as a Social Security or credit card number.
